I haven't read that one so couldn't say. They are all taking a look at the latest scientific studies and findings. The one about fat takes a look at different types of fat, and how some fats like ones in dairy products, aren't as bad for you as previously thought, and can even be good for you. The fats in meats tend to be the bad ones. They also take a look at excersise, and discoveries have been made that show if you excercise intensley for two minutes, then rest for one minute, then repeat this 7 times, you actually continue to burn off fat after this and in to the day, even when not doing anything. Thats only a couple of things in the programs, there's loads more. The Sugar one is pretty mind blowing too, seeing the amount of sugar manufacturers put in to a single bottle of ginger beer, 20 teaspoons !! Take a look http://www.bbc.co.uk/programmes/p02lrndx
